Toxic masculinity is the adherence to traditional male gender roles, which can put men in a box, limiting the acceptance of them expressing themselves in ways that are seen as opposite to the alpha male ideal. The difference between toxic masculinity and masculinity is that with toxic masculinity, men are shamed for behaviors seen as feminine or for not meeting the masculine ideal. In 2011, Virginia Tech began assigning helmet ratings to new products on the market as a response to the growing concern for head injuries in various sports. The ratings are unbiased and completely independent from the influence of helmet manufacturers. The best rated football helmets will score highly on the Virginia Tech helmet ratings while also being comfortable and stylish. A number of factors have to be considered when choosing the best football shoulder pads for game day and practice. Shoulder pads have to be somewhat lightweight so that a player isn't bogged down running while also being able to absorb hits and disperse force throughout them. Good gear helps make the best shutdown comebacks of all time happen. They should also offer a wide range of motion and flexibility so that players are not restricted when running or tackling.
